Josh Arieh Poker Player Biography

Josh Arieh was born in Rochester, New York in 1974. As a poker player, he is known for his aggressive and unpredictable style of play, and has been pegged as being a "trash talker" at the tables. He competes in all varieties of poker, and has been playing for over 12 years in the Atlanta area (where he resides). Josh competes in 12 or more major tournaments (buy-ins over $10,000) each year.

In addition to live poker, Josh likes to play online poker as well. In fact, Josh plays up to 70 hours per week of online poker. He is part of "Team Bodog" and has his own table at Bodog, on which he plays frequently.

Among Josh Arieh's many accomplishments are the following:

  • 1999 - won the World Series of Poker Limit Holdem event - $202,800
  • 2000 - 2nd in WSOP Pot Limit Omaha event - $80,000
  • 2003 - 2nd at Bellagio's Five Diamond World Poker Classic
  • 2004 - 3rd at World Series of Poker main event - $2,500,000
  • 2004 - 3rd at WPT Borgata event - $286,900
  • 2005 - won the WSOP Pot Limit Omaha event - $311,600
  • 14 final table appearances
  • 23rd all-time money winner at World Series of Poker
  • total earnings $3,600,000
